Unsay

see synonyms of unsay

Verb

1. swallow, take back, unsay, withdraw

take back what one has said

Example Sentences:
'He swallowed his words'

Unsay

see synonyms of unsay
verb -says, -saying or -said
(transitive)
to retract or withdraw (something said or written)
